Tuticorin custodial deaths: CB-CID arrests 5 more cops

 P Jayaraj and his son Fennix, arrested for 'violating' the coronavirus lockdown norms over business hours of their cellphone shop, died at a hospital in Kovilpatti on June 23

Tuticorin:  The Tamil Nadu CB-CID arrested five more police officers in connection with the Tuticorin custodial deaths of father and son. It is reported that the arrested officials were questioned for 15 hours before their arrests.

The police officers are Palthurai, Chellathurai, Samathurai, Velmuthu, and Thomas. Presently the cops are shifted to Thoothukudi for a medical examination.

Days ago, an inspector, two sub-inspectors (SIs) and two constables were taken to custody in connection with the case.

Jayaraj, 59, and his 31-year-old son Fennix were taken to the police station on June 20 for violating lockdown rules. The duo was allegedly beaten to death by police.
